- Chapter 1 -
Ammora knelt by the riverside, vigorously washing the crude animal skin clothes of her family. Most of her days began down here by the river – either drawing water, washing clothes, or playing with the children when the weather was nice. Today was all business though. Her husband, Esarh, had ben called away by the Great General for a meeting of some kind. He had been gone for days now. Ammora tried focus on her work… and tried not to worry. Before long she settled into a rhythm of rinsing, scrubbing, and wringing out the water as the river gently babbled along.
Suddenly, her work was interrupted by the sound of male voices shouting. Ammora jumped to her feet, dropped her washing, and ran up the gently sloping river bank. As she reached the crest, she could see the group of 3 men running towards the large hut that Ammora's family shared with 2 other families. She strained her eyes to try to recognize the men, and then yelped with glee when she recognized Esarh among the men hurrying home.
As she ran to meet her husband, she was able to hear what he was shouting for the first time… "A city… A city… The Great General says that we will build a city!"
Ammora wondered what this "city" was that they were all so excited about it… but there was time to find out more about that latter. For now, she was just happy to have her husband home.
